3320155445452 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 5810272029548. Its totient is φ = 1660077722724.
The previous prime is 3320155445423. The next prime is 3320155445459. The reversal of 3320155445452 is 2545445510233.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×33201554454522 (a number of 26 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 3320155445399 and 3320155445408.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(3320155445459)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 415019430678 + ... + 415019430685.
Almost surely, 23320155445452 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
3320155445452 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(2490116584096).
3320155445452 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
3320155445452 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 830038861367 (or 830038861365 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1440000, while the sum is 43.
